Cub Scout Day Camp - held in each of the seven districts in late May to early June, camps are one to four days in length. A great end of the school year activity.
Cub Scout Fun Day - held in September or early October it is a great way to get the school year started with an outdoor activity. Fun Days are held across the council and some include an overnight camp. A great activity for all Cub Scouts, especially for new members.
Cub Scout Adventure Camps - are family camps, the entire family can attend. Offered in the Spring and Fall, these are Saturday-Sunday and are held at Camp Brown and Camp Hansen.
Fun with Son Overnights - are family camps, the entire family can attend. Offered once each summer at Camp Hansen and Camp Brown on a Saturday-Sunday.
Cub Scout Resident Camp - a three-day, two-night camp held during the summer for Cub Scouts going into grades two and three that fall. One camp each at Camp Brown and Camp Hansen. Many programs offered, campfires and one cookout meal.
Webelos Resident Camp - a three-day, two-night camp held during the summer for Cub Scouts going into grades four and five that fall. Two sessions at Camp Brown and one session at Camp Hansen. Many programs offered, campfires and one cookout meal. Activity badges are offered on a two year cycle, for a total of nine activity badges over two summers.
Boy Scout Resident Camp - a week long program offered at Camp Hansen. Many programs to choose from including: Trail to Eagle (first year Scouts), numerous merit badges and other programs like - mountain boards, mountain bikes, climbing, rappelling, kayaking, snorkeling, SCUBA, etc.
High Adventure - the council sponsors a trek to Philmont Scout Ranch (see link below) and Scouts that are at least 16 years of age and members of Kidi Kidish Lodge can attend Philmont Scout Ranch or Northern Tier Canoe Base (see Kidi Kidish Lodge page).
